Graeme Moir, in Advanced Concrete Technology, 2003. 1.3.2 The modern rotary kiln. The rotary kilns used in the first half of the twentieth century were wet process kilns which were fed with raw mix in the form of a slurry. Moisture contents were typically 40% by mass and although the wet process enabled the raw mix to be homogenized easily, it carried a very heavy fuel penalty as

Mar 16, 2021 “The first rotary kiln operates at 500 C and produced pyoil coke and pygas. The second, smaller kiln, uses a small amount of stem injection at about 15 to 20% by mass and takes the coke from the first kiln and operates at 900 C to create a hydrogen-rich gas.”
These tests form the basis for determining the layout and achievable capacity of a plant. Our standard rotary kiln (4.8 x 80 m) is capable of producing up to 160,000 tons DRI per annum depending on the raw material. In the SL/RN-Xtra version, this figure goes up to 200,000 t/a

Kilns are heated by horizontal space burners with gas, liquid, or solid fuel. A rotary kiln is a cylindrical steel tube lined with insulating brick. The large ones can be as long as 760 feet with a diameter of 25 feet. The kiln turns on a horizontal axis

The calcining of the gypsum, is done inside the rotary kiln, HR3 or HR5 according to the required capacity.It is a continuous, and counter current, rotary kiln, and the gases are in contact with the product.It is designed to produce 100% of plaster / plaster of Paris, or 100% of Anhydrite II because of the high temperatures for calcining the product, up to 800 C
Rotary kiln combustion chamber, with drive motor and gear box, to avoid piek in concentration we need the correct software Secondary combustion chamber, also called post combustion chamber, with support burner to have 1200 degrees C and a residence time of min. 2 sec. for complete combustion, important for CO and dioxins and furans
Rotary Kiln The rotary kiln is 13.0 feet in diameter inside the shell and 36.8 feet in length, and rotates in the range of 0.07-0.6 rpm. Nine to twelve-inch thick high-alumina brick refractory lin-ing protects the shell. The kiln is designed to operate with a maximum flue gas temperature of 2400 F at the discharge end
